diff --git a/L2J_DataPack_BETA/dist/game/data/scripts/handlers/effecthandlers/CancelDebuff.java b/L2J_DataPack_BETA/dist/game/data/scripts/handlers/effecthandlers/CancelDebuff.java index 9a2345b4a5a8d261e426ff8eca22ee72b5017e11..b16059d1f60b890a27185a2341aae55317307501 100644 --- a/L2J_DataPack_BETA/dist/game/data/scripts/handlers/effecthandlers/CancelDebuff.java +++ b/L2J_DataPack_BETA/dist/game/data/scripts/handlers/effecthandlers/CancelDebuff.java @@ -14,7 +14,6 @@ */ package handlers.effecthandlers; -import com.l2jserver.Config; import com.l2jserver.gameserver.model.actor.L2Character; import com.l2jserver.gameserver.model.effects.EffectTemplate; import com.l2jserver.gameserver.model.effects.L2Effect; @@ -108,13 +107,13 @@ public class CancelDebuff extends L2Effect rate += (effect.getAbnormalTime() - effect.getTime()) / 1200; rate += baseRate; - if (rate < Config.MIN_DEBUFF_CHANCE) + if (rate < effect.getSkill().getMinChance()) { - rate = Config.MIN_DEBUFF_CHANCE; + rate = effect.getSkill().getMinChance(); } - else if (rate > Config.MAX_DEBUFF_CHANCE) + else if (rate > effect.getSkill().getMaxChance()) { - rate = Config.MAX_DEBUFF_CHANCE; + rate = effect.getSkill().getMaxChance(); } return Rnd.get(100) < rate;